What is the fuel pressure of a 2002 Honda Odyssey?

The fuel pressure for a 2002 Honda Odyssey typically ranges from 40 to 50 psi (pounds per square inch) when the engine is running. This pressure is essential for proper fuel delivery to the engine. If the fuel pressure is outside this range, it could indicate issues with the fuel pump, fuel filter, or fuel pressure regulator. 1999 Ford truck will start but acts like it isn't getting fuel and quits?

Could be a fuel filter or fuel pump is weak. Change fuel filter and check output pressure of the fuel pump at the Schrader valve on the fuel rail. You will need a fuel pressure gauge. At idle you should be getting at LEAST 30 to 50 psi.
